Microsoft this month announced that the IndexNow protocol is now working with Yandex and Bing. The IndexNow protocol helps search engines to index the web.
IndexNow is a protocol that submits URLs to search engines, when URLs are added, updated, or deleted.
According to Microsoft, more than 80,000 websites have already started publishing using the IndexNow protocol.
All Search Engines adopting the IndexNow protocol agree that submitted URLs will be automatically shared with all other participating Search Engines. Microsoft says the IndexNow protocol can help the entire search industry get their content indexed faster, while using less resources.
To support IndexNow, Microsoft launched a plugin for WordPress that submits the URLs via the IndexNow API. Cloudflare, last year, launched Crawler Hints, a free service that improves the efficiency of the traffic that comes from web crawlers. When Cloudflare users activate the Crawler Hints (in Cache), their websites have the urls submitted via IndexNow.
